Manager Guidelines
The OHSU Department of Public Safety partners with managers to jointly address employee smoking on the OHSU campus. As part of this plan, Public Safety officers report employees who are repeatedly observed smoking on campus to their managers for follow-up. It is each manager’s responsibility to address any employee violations of the tobacco-free policy, as with all OHSU policies.
